Product details

Overview

AD7391ANZ from Analog Devices is a 10-bit, single-supply voltage-output DAC designed for micropower battery-operated systems. It operates from 2.7 V to 5.5 V, consumes ≤100 µA, features rail-to-rail output (0 V to VREF), and uses SPI-compatible 3-wire serial interface (SDI/CLK/LD) with Schmitt-trigger inputs - enabling reliable operation in automotive sensor calibration and portable instrumentation.

Technical Context

The AD7391ANZ implements a voltage-switched R-2R ladder DAC architecture with laser-trimmed thin-film resistors, delivering monotonic 10-bit performance without missing codes. Its internal rail-to-rail output amplifier provides ±1 mA sourcing/sinking capability and drives up to 100 pF capacitive loads while maintaining stability.

Digital control uses a double-buffered serial interface: 10-bit MSB-first data is clocked into a shift register on CLK rising edges, then transferred to the DAC register on LD falling edge. The dedicated CLR pin forces zero-scale output independently of other logic states, supporting deterministic power-on initialization.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Resolution 10-bit - delivers 1024 discrete output levels; LSB step = VREF/1024 (e.g., 2.44 mV at VREF = 2.5 V)
INL (max) ±2.0 LSB over –40°C to +85°C - ensures monotonicity and <0.2% full-scale linearity error in industrial environments
Settling Time 70 µs to 0.1% of full scale - enables update rates up to ~14 kHz in closed-loop control loops
Supply Current 100 µA max at 25°C - supports >1-year battery life in coin-cell-powered IoT endpoints
Reference Range 0 V to VDD - allows ratiometric operation with ADCs or direct VDD-referenced output spanning 0–5.5 V
Output Drive ±1 mA (source/sink) - directly interfaces with 5 kΩ loads or op-amp input stages without external buffering
Logic Interface SPI/QSPI-compatible 3-wire (SDI/CLK/LD); Schmitt-trigger inputs tolerate slow edges and mixed-voltage signaling

Pinout & Package

AD7391ANZ is supplied in an 8-lead plastic DIP (N-8) package with 0.3-inch body width and through-hole mounting. Pin spacing is 0.1 inch (2.54 mm), compatible with standard PCB layouts and socketing.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
1 - LD Load Strobe Active-low signal transferring data from shift register to DAC register; enables synchronous updates without output glitches
2 - CLK Clock Input Positive-edge-triggered serial clock; minimum pulse width 30 ns at 5 V - supports microcontroller SPI peripherals up to 33 MHz
3 - SDI Serial Data Input MSB-first 10-bit data input; Schmitt-triggered for noise immunity on long traces or noisy boards
4 - CLR Clear Input Asynchronous active-low reset forcing DAC register to 0x000 and VOUT to 0 V - used for power-on initialization or fault recovery
5 - GND Analog & Digital Ground Single common ground pin; requires low-impedance connection to minimize digital switching noise coupling into analog output
6 - VOUT Analog Voltage Output Rail-to-rail buffered output; full-scale = VREF × (D/1024); capable of driving 5 kΩ || 100 pF loads
7 - VDD Positive Supply 2.7 V to 5.5 V single supply; powers both digital logic and analog output stage; bypassing with 10 µF + 0.1 µF recommended
8 - VREF Reference Input High-impedance (2.5 MΩ) reference node; sets full-scale output; accepts DC or AC signals within 0 V to VDD range

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Micropower Operation 100 µA max supply current enables multi-year battery life in portable medical monitors and wireless sensors
Rail-to-Rail Output VOUT swings from 0 V to VREF - maximizes dynamic range when using single-supply rails like 3.3 V or 5 V
Pin-Compatible Family Shares identical SO-8/DIP-8 pinout with AD7390 (12-bit), allowing resolution upgrades without PCB redesign
Zero-Scale Reset CLR pin forces guaranteed 0 V output regardless of register state - critical for safety-critical actuator control
Robust Digital Interface Schmitt-trigger inputs reject noise and support 3 V/5 V logic level mixing - simplifies interfacing with legacy microcontrollers

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ar DAC appl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
AD7391AR Same 10-bit DAC core, but in SO-8 package (vs. DIP-8); rated for –40°C to +125°C automotive grade Required for under-hood automotive modules or high-temp industrial enclosures where DIP thermal performance is insufficient Select AD7391AR when surface-mount assembly, extended temperature operation, or smaller footprint is mandatory
AD5300BRMZ 10-bit DAC in MSOP-8; higher 125 µA max IDD; ±4 LSB INL; no CLR pin; uses 2-wire I²C interface instead of SPI Suitable for space-constrained I²C-based systems where asynchronous reset is not required and slightly lower linearity is acceptable Choose AD5300BRMZ only if board layout favors MSOP-8 and system already uses I²C infrastructure - not a drop-in replacement

Compared with AD7391ANZ, AD7391AR offers identical electrical performance in a surface-mount package with extended temperature rating, while AD5300BRMZ trades SPI interface and CLR functionality for I²C compatibility and smaller size - neither is pin-compatible, but both serve overlapping low-power 10-bit DAC use cases.

FAQ

What is the maximum operating temperature range for AD7391ANZ?

The AD7391ANZ is specified for operation from –40°C to +85°C. This extended industrial temperature range ensures reliable performance in demanding environments such as factory automation controllers and outdoor instrumentation. While the AD7391AR variant extends to +125°C for automotive under-hood use, the AD7391ANZ maintains full electrical specifications across its rated range without derating.

Does AD7391ANZ require an external reference voltage?

No - AD7391ANZ supports ratiometric operation by connecting VREF directly to VDD, enabling a full-scale output of 0 V to VDD. This eliminates the need for a precision external reference in cost-sensitive applications. When higher accuracy is required, a stable 2.5 V or 5.0 V reference (e.g., ADR4525) can be applied to VREF, leveraging the device's 2.5 MΩ input resistance and low reference current sensitivity.

Can AD7391ANZ interface directly with a 5 V microcontroller while powered from 3.3 V?

Yes - AD7391ANZ features Schmitt-trigger digital inputs with overvoltage tolerance up to 8 V, allowing safe interfacing with 5 V logic signals even when VDD = 3.3 V. The VIH threshold is VDD – 0.6 V (≥2.7 V at 3.3 V), and VIL is ≤0.5 V, ensuring reliable recognition of 5 V logic highs and lows without level-shifting circuitry.

What is the purpose of the CLR pin on AD7391ANZ?

The CLR (Clear) pin on AD7391ANZ is an asynchronous active-low input that forces the DAC register to zero and drives VOUT to 0 V regardless of current data or clock state. This provides deterministic power-on reset behavior and enables rapid fault recovery in safety-critical systems like motor controllers or medical devices - a feature not present in many competing 10-bit DACs.

How does AD7391ANZ handle capacitive loads on its VOUT pin?

AD7391ANZ's rail-to-rail output amplifier is characterized to drive up to 100 pF capacitive loads without oscillation or excessive overshoot. For loads exceeding this, a small series resistor (e.g., 10–50 Ω) between VOUT and the capacitor is recommended to maintain stability. The internal 35 Ω N-channel pull-down FET and P-channel pull-up device ensure consistent sourcing/sinking performance across the full output range.
